The project, which is slated for commissioning in 42 months, will be one of the largest hydro power stations in the state of Kerala on completion.
Our combined knowledge, your competitive advantage
The project, which is slated for commissioning in 42 months, will be one of the largest hydro power stations in the state of Kerala on completion.